About Office Solutions Law in Potchefstroom, South Africa

Office Solutions in Potchefstroom, South Africa, encompasses a wide range of legal areas that relate to the establishment, operation, and management of offices. This includes lease agreements, workplace safety, and employee relations, as well as compliance with local regulations and national laws governing commercial operations. As one of the economic hubs in the North West Province, Potchefstroom provides a dynamic environment for businesses to thrive, making it essential for office managers and entrepreneurs to have a clear understanding of the legal landscape.

Local Laws Overview

In Potchefstroom, as in the rest of South Africa, commercial operations are subject to both national laws and local regulations. Key laws and regulations relevant to Office Solutions include:

  • The Occupational Health and Safety Act, which mandates the implementation of safety measures to protect employees.
  • The Labour Relations Act, providing a framework for resolving employment-related disputes and ensuring workers' rights.
  • The Companies Act, relevant for office-based businesses concerning incorporation, governance, and compliance obligations.
  • Local zoning laws that dictate the types of businesses that can operate in specific areas and the requirements they must meet.
  • The Protection of Personal Information Act (POPIA), regulating data protection and privacy in customer and employee information.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the legal requirements for leasing office space in Potchefstroom?

Leasing office space requires a written agreement that complies with the South African Contract Law, including terms on rent, lease period, and conditions for renewal or termination.

How can I resolve a dispute with my landlord over office property?

Disputes can often be resolved through negotiation or mediation, but if necessary, legal action may be taken through local courts or dispute resolution tribunals.

What are the health and safety obligations for office environments?

Employers need to ensure that their offices comply with health and safety regulations, including adequate ventilation, sanitation, and the provision of necessary safety equipment.

Are there specific labor laws that apply to hiring office staff?

Yes, employment contracts must comply with the Labour Relations Act, covering aspects like wages, working hours, and conditions of employment.

How do I protect my business's intellectual property in the office?

Businesses should consult legal experts to understand how to safeguard intellectual property through copyright, patents, and trademarks, ensuring compliance with the Intellectual Property Laws Amendment Act.

What should I include in an employee contract?

Contracts should include job responsibilities, compensation, working hours, conflict resolution processes, and termination procedures to comply with labor laws.

How can I ensure data protection in my office-based business?

Complying with the POPIA involves creating data protection policies, training employees on privacy best practices, and securing sensitive information against unauthorized access.

What are the obligations for waste management in office settings?

Businesses must adhere to local environmental regulations that outline proper waste disposal methods to minimize environmental impact and ensure public health.

Do I need a business license to operate an office in Potchefstroom?

Yes, most office-based businesses will require a local business license, which can be obtained from the local municipality, subject to compliance with zoning laws.

How can I stay updated with changes in Office Solutions laws?

Regularly consulting with legal professionals, subscribing to legal updates, and attending industry seminars or workshops can help you stay informed about legal changes affecting office operations.
